[QUOTE="MickyMook, post: 6850319, member: 82116"] I’ve some forage rape that I’ve been strip grazing cows on over winter. It’s currently getting into flower so I think it’s time I took the cows off it as I’m led to believe they’re more prone to brassica poisoning at this stage. Ive heard that ewes are less susceptible - could I strip graze my newly lambed ewes on this with a grass lie back to help their milk? Has anyone had any bother? [/QUOTE]
